Abstract

A method, an apparatus, and a computer program product for scaling of subscriber capacity in a cloud native radio access network (RAN). A processing capacity being assigned to one or more containers in a plurality of containers of a cloud native radio access network for providing communication to at least one user equipment in a plurality of user equipments is determined. The determined processing capacity is compared to at least one predetermined threshold in a plurality of predetermined thresholds. Based on the comparing a determination is made whether to change an assignment of the processing capacity.

Claims (39)

1. A computer-implemented method, comprising:

determining a processing capacity being assigned to one or more containers in a plurality of containers of a cloud native radio access network for providing communication to at least one user equipment in a plurality of user equipments;

comparing the determined processing capacity to at least one predetermined threshold in a plurality of predetermined thresholds; and

determining, based on the comparing, whether to change an assignment of the processing capacity.

2.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ising changing the assignment of the processing capacity.

3.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the one or more containers are associated with at least one of: at least one control plane component and at least user plane component of a centralized unit of a base station,

wherein the determining whether to change the assignment of the processing capacity assigned includes at least one of the following: increasing a number of user equipments being processed by the at least one control plane component by increasing a number of containers providing communication to the user equipments, decreasing a number of user equipments being processed by the at least one control plane component by decreasing the number of containers providing communication to the user equipments, increasing a throughout capacity of the at least one user plane component by increasing the number of containers providing communication to the user equipments, decreasing a throughput capacity of the at least one user plane component by decreasing the number of containers providing communication to the user equipments, and any combinations thereof.

4. The method according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of the determining the processing capacity, the comparing, and the determining whether to change the assignment of the processing capacity is performed by at least one base station in a wireless communication system.

5. The method according to claim 4 , where the base station includes at least one of the following: a base station, an eNodeB base station, a gNodeB base station, a wireless base station, a wireless access point, and any combination thereof.

6. The method according to claim 5 , wherein the base station is a base station operating in at least one of the following communications systems: a long term evolution communications system, a new radio communications system, a wireless communication system, and any combination thereof.

7. The method according to claim 4 , wherein the base station includes at least one centralized unit, the centralized unit include at least one of: a control plane component, a user plane component, and any combination thereof.

8. The method according to claim 1 , wherein one or more user equipments in the plurality of user equipments is associated with a radio resource control (RRC) status, the RRC status including at least one of the following: an RRC-inactive status, no RRC-inactive status, an RRC connected status, and any combination thereof.

9. The method according to claim 8 , wherein one or more predetermined weights are assigned to the one or more user equipments in the plurality of user equipments based on the RRC status.

10. The method according to claim 9 , wherein the at least one predetermined threshold is selected from a plurality of predetermined thresholds based on the RRC status of the one or more user equipments.

11. The method according to claim 10 , wherein the comparing includes comparing the determined processing capacity determined for the one or more user equipments having assigned the one or more predetermined weights to the at least one predetermined threshold selected based on the RRC status of the one or more user equipments.

12.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ising

transitioning, based on the determining whether to change the processing capacity, the at least one user equipment assigned to the at least one container to at least another container in the plurality of containers; and

providing, using the at least another container, communication to the transitioned at least one user equipment.

13. The method according to claim 12 , further comprising preventing, subsequent to the transitioning, the at least one container from providing communication to at least another user equipment in the plurality of user equipments.

14. The method according to claim 12 , further comprising changing at least one identifier of the transitioned at least one user equipment.

15. The method according to claim 12 , further comprising preventing changing at least one identifier of the transitioned at least one user equipment.

16. The method according to claim 14 , wherein the at least one identifier includes at least one of the following: a user equipment identifier, a user equipment bearer identifier, at least one user plane endpoint address, an internet protocol (IP) address, a GPRS tunneling protocol user data tunneling endpoint identifier (GTP-U TEID), and any combination thereof associated with the at least one user equipment.

17. The method according to claim 16 , wherein the at least one identifier is stored in at least one database, the one or more containers being configured to retrieve the at least one identifier from the at least one database, and assign the retrieved at least one identifier to the transitioned at least one user equipment.

18. The method according to claim 17 , wherein the at least one database stores a mapping between the retrieved at least one identifier and the one or more containers.

19.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one predetermined threshold includes at least one of the following: a first threshold associated with increasing the processing capacity, a second threshold associated with decreasing the processing capacity, and any combination thereof.

20. The method according to claim 19 , wherein the comparing includes comparing at least one of: one or more user equipments having with a predetermined radio resource control (RRC) status and being associated with a first predetermined weight, a number of communications from the one or more user equipments processed by the one or more containers per a predetermined period of time, a throughput associated with the one or more containers, and any combination thereof, with at least one of the first threshold and the second threshold.

21. The method according to claim 20 , wherein the changing the assignment of the processing capacity includes at least one of:

increasing, based on the comparing, the processing capacity upon exceeding the first threshold; and

decreasing, based on the comparing, the processing capacity upon not exceeding the second threshold.
